What are Mixed Numbers and Improper Fractions?

Before diving into the intricacies of conversions and operations, let's clarify the definitions of our key players:

  • Improper Fractions: An improper fraction is a fraction where the numerator (the top number) is greater than or equal to the denominator (the bottom number). Here's one way to look at it: 7/4, 11/5, and 9/9 are all improper fractions. The numerator represents the number of parts, and the denominator represents the size of each part. In an improper fraction, we have more parts than needed to make a whole.

  • Mixed Numbers: A mixed number combines a whole number and a proper fraction. A proper fraction has a numerator smaller than its denominator (e.g., 1/2, 3/4, 5/8). Here's one way to look at it: 2 ¾, 1 ⅔, and 5 ¹⁄₁₀ are all mixed numbers. Mixed numbers offer a more intuitive way to represent quantities larger than one.

2. Converting an Improper Fraction to a Mixed Number:

This conversion requires division:

  • Step 1: Divide the numerator by the denominator. The quotient (the result of the division) becomes the whole number part of the mixed number.
  • Step 2: The remainder becomes the numerator of the proper fraction. The denominator remains the same as the original improper fraction.

Example: Convert the improper fraction 11/4 to a mixed number.

  1. Divide the numerator (11) by the denominator (4): 11 ÷ 4 = 2 with a remainder of 3.
  2. The whole number is 2. The remainder (3) becomes the new numerator, and the denominator remains 4.
  3. The mixed number is 2 ¾.

Adding and Subtracting Mixed Numbers and Improper Fractions

Adding and subtracting mixed numbers and improper fractions often requires converting to a common form for ease of calculation. While you can add and subtract mixed numbers directly, converting to improper fractions first is often simpler, especially for more complex problems.

1. Adding Mixed Numbers:

  • Method 1: Convert to Improper Fractions: Convert both mixed numbers to improper fractions, find a common denominator, add the numerators, and simplify the result. Then convert the resulting improper fraction back to a mixed number if needed.

  • Method 2: Add Whole Numbers and Fractions Separately: Add the whole numbers together. Then add the fractions, finding a common denominator if necessary. Finally, combine the whole number sum and the fraction sum. Simplify if necessary.

Example (Method 1): Add 2 ¾ + 1 ⅔

  1. Convert to improper fractions: 2 ¾ = 11/4 and 1 ⅔ = 5/3
  2. Find a common denominator (12): 11/4 = 33/12 and 5/3 = 20/12
  3. Add the numerators: 33/12 + 20/12 = 53/12
  4. Convert back to a mixed number: 53/12 = 4 5/12

Example (Method 2): Add 2 ¾ + 1 ⅔

  1. Add whole numbers: 2 + 1 = 3
  2. Add fractions: ¾ + ⅔ = 9/12 + 8/12 = 17/12 = 1 5/12
  3. Combine: 3 + 1 5/12 = 4 5/12

Multiplying and Dividing Mixed Numbers and Improper Fractions

Multiplication and division involving mixed numbers usually benefit from converting mixed numbers to improper fractions before proceeding.

1. Multiplying Mixed Numbers and Improper Fractions:

  • Convert to Improper Fractions: Convert all mixed numbers to improper fractions.
  • Multiply Numerators and Denominators: Multiply the numerators together and the denominators together.
  • Simplify: Simplify the resulting fraction and convert back to a mixed number if needed.

Example: Multiply 2 ½ x 1 ⅓

  1. Convert to improper fractions: 2 ½ = 5/2 and 1 ⅓ = 4/3
  2. Multiply numerators and denominators: (5/2) x (4/3) = 20/6
  3. Simplify: 20/6 = 10/3
  4. Convert to a mixed number: 10/3 = 3 ⅓

2. Dividing Mixed Numbers and Improper Fractions:

  • Convert to Improper Fractions: Convert all mixed numbers to improper fractions.
  • Invert the Second Fraction (Reciprocal): Invert the second fraction (divisor) and change the division sign to multiplication.
  • Multiply: Multiply the numerators and denominators as in multiplication.
  • Simplify: Simplify the resulting fraction and convert to a mixed number if needed.

Example: Divide 2 ¾ ÷ 1 ½

  1. Convert to improper fractions: 2 ¾ = 11/4 and 1 ½ = 3/2
  2. Invert the second fraction: 3/2 becomes 2/3
  3. Multiply: (11/4) x (2/3) = 22/12
  4. Simplify: 22/12 = 11/6
  5. Convert to a mixed number: 11/6 = 1 ⁵⁄₆

Real-World Applications of Mixed Numbers and Improper Fractions

Mixed numbers and improper fractions are far from abstract mathematical concepts. They have numerous real-world applications:

  • Cooking and Baking: Recipes often use mixed numbers (e.g., 2 ½ cups of flour).
  • Measurement: Measuring lengths, volumes, and weights frequently involves mixed numbers (e.g., 3 ⅓ feet).
  • Construction: Construction projects rely on precise measurements using fractions and mixed numbers.
  • Finance: Calculating portions of amounts or interest often involves fractional calculations.
